To effectively kill snails on your cabbage, you can use several methods. Handpicking them off the plants during the early morning or evening can be effective. Additionally, applying diatomaceous earth around the base of the plants can deter and kill snails. For a more chemical approach, consider using iron phosphate-based baits, which are safe for plants and pets while being effective against snails.

There are many chemicals that will kill freshwater snails but they will also kill fish and some will kill plants too. The best way I have found to remove snails is to have a few Clown loaches (Botia macracantha) or a couple of freshwater Puffer fish to kill and eat them.
